             |               I used the 
            QBP Travel Agent to replaced the noodle only to reduce alittle friction
            and help aid cable life.
 These are not a straight bolt on addition if you want them to
 work 100% careful care must be taken in alignment of the cable 
            exiting the
 Travel Agent so its centered as it exits the Travel Agent by fine 
            tuning the
 outer cable housing length and routing of the cable to get it 
            correct.
 If alignment is off the inner cable will rub the exit hole on the
 Travel Agent and it will bind more then the noodle
 and cut the cable in a short time.

            |  |   This is a bracket I made so we can attach ourtrailer to the Trek T900. I had no way to put this bracket on the
 rear QR so this was fabricated using the mounting
 holes in the frame for a disc brake bracket.
